Case Report: Prolonged remission of metastatic cisplatin-refractory nasopharyngeal carcinoma with Pembrolizumab

Abstract

Background: Epstein-Barr virus (EBV)-related nasopharyngeal cancer (NPC) is a common type of cancer in certain areas of the world such as southeast Asia, but is uncommon in Canada. There is currently no reliably effective standard treatment for incurable metastatic EBV-related NPC that progresses after first-line therapy with gemcitabine/cisplatin.
